Description
Genre: Alternative
DAW: FL Studio

A sci-fi survival, kind of like Spore except you are a single life form that is already quite developed and capable of hunting, climbing, and communicating. Similar life forms were on the meteorite that crashed, and they were scattered across the planet to strive for themselves. You are one of them. The ending of the game would be to either befriend everyone and live in harmony, or well, failure where you die alone or with everyone. Either way, the ending will be peaceful in their own way. Communication will be a big part of the game, as you may instruct friendly life forms to perform tasks, but they may make mistakes or not listen, depending on how they are treated.
There are four tracks which I have combined into one. The introduction to how the player comes to the planet and is met with hostility, not just other creatures but the environment, too. The first track is chaotic. As everything adjusts to an equilibrium after the meteorite crash, things soothe out which lets the player explore the world with the second track. The exploration will eventually lead to a conflict with other creatures. The third track is more organized than the first because the creatures have figured many things out, so fighting is not the player’s only option. Then whatever the resolution for the conflict is, the fourth track, which is a reprise of the second track kicks in. Calming, for returning to a familiar world where the cycle will repeat. The exploration and conflict cycle will need to be perfected as it will be what the player does throughout the game. These four tracks will be split up and looped depending on where the player is on their journey, and blended into each other when they need to change.
